Provide operational and administrative support for the Academic Advising department with an emphasis on providing excellent customer (student) service.
Serve as a primary point of contact for Academic Advising front office, answering calls and emails and transferring calls/emails to the department.
Tend to the front desk, greeting walk-in visitors and assisting them in answering inquires. Direct visitors as needed to the appropriate department.
Perform general office administration tasks including but not limited to, photocopying, data entry, filing, and records maintenance.
Receive, scan, log, or direct confidential student documents/records, adhering to College, State, and Federal guidelines.
Review and maintain website for campus advising coverage.
Review Starfish alerts and assign flags notices to assigned academic advisor.
Connect students with academic advisors (virtually).
Address academic advising emails, forwarding the assigned academic advisor when necessary (Starfish).
Review and respond to all student Starfish Intake forms.
Maintain records and reports for certification and assessment purposes.
Associate's degree or equivalent education in any field. Degree requirement may be substituted with equivalent work experience.
One year of related professional work experience, preferably in an academic setting.Interpersonal and customer service skills.
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
Experience in higher education.
